Understanding DWI Case Support Services


DWI case support services cover a range of assessments and counseling designed to address substance use and related behaviors. These services are not just about meeting court requirements. They are about helping you regain control and build a healthier future.


When you engage with DWI case support services, you typically start with an assessment. This assessment evaluates your alcohol or drug use, your risk factors, and your readiness for change. It helps professionals create a personalized plan that fits your needs.


Some key components of these services include:


  • Substance use evaluation: A detailed review of your drinking or drug habits.

  • Risk assessment: Identifying behaviors that may lead to future legal or health problems.

  • Counseling sessions: One-on-one or group therapy to address underlying issues.

  • Education programs: Learning about the effects of alcohol and drugs on your body and mind.

  • Referral to treatment: If needed, connecting you with specialized treatment programs.


These services are designed to be supportive and non-judgmental. The goal is to help you understand your situation and take positive steps forward.

Why DWI Case Support Services Matter in Texas


Texas has some of the toughest DWI laws in the country. Penalties can include fines, license suspension, and even jail time. Beyond the legal consequences, a DWI charge can affect your job, family, and mental health.


DWI case support services in Texas are essential because they:


  • Help you comply with court orders.

  • Provide tools to reduce the risk of future offenses.

  • Support your mental and emotional well-being.

  • Offer education that can change your relationship with alcohol or drugs.

  • Connect you with community resources for ongoing support.


By participating in these services, you show the court and your community that you are serious about making changes. This can positively influence your case and your life.


Can you do an alcohol assessment online?


In today’s digital world, many people wonder if they can complete an alcohol assessment online. The answer is yes, but with some important considerations.


Online alcohol assessments can be convenient and private. They allow you to answer questions about your drinking habits from the comfort of your home. Some programs offer immediate feedback and recommendations based on your answers.


However, not all online assessments are accepted by Texas courts. It is crucial to choose a program that meets legal standards and is recognized by local authorities. Many providers offer hybrid models where the initial assessment is online, followed by in-person counseling or verification.


If you are considering an online assessment, here are some tips:


  1. Verify court acceptance: Check if the online assessment is approved for your case.

  2. Choose licensed providers: Ensure the service is run by qualified professionals.

  3. Follow up with counseling: Use the assessment as a first step, not the entire process.

  4. Keep documentation: Save all reports and certificates for court hearings.


Online assessments can be a helpful part of your DWI case support, but they work best when combined with personal interaction and ongoing support.

How to Prepare for Your DWI Assessment


Preparing for your DWI assessment can make the process smoother and more effective. Here are some practical steps to help you get ready:


  • Be honest: The assessment works best when you provide truthful answers. This helps professionals understand your situation accurately.

  • Gather documents: Bring any relevant paperwork, such as court orders, previous assessments, or treatment records.

  • Reflect on your habits: Think about your alcohol or drug use patterns, triggers, and any past attempts to change.

  • Ask questions: Don’t hesitate to clarify what the assessment involves and what to expect afterward.

  • Stay calm: Remember, the goal is to support you, not to judge or punish.


By approaching the assessment with openness and readiness, you set the stage for meaningful progress.


What Happens After the Assessment?


Once your assessment is complete, you will receive a report outlining the findings and recommendations. This report is often shared with the court, your attorney, and the treatment provider.


Based on the results, you may be advised to:


  • Attend educational classes about alcohol and drug use.

  • Participate in individual or group counseling.

  • Enroll in a treatment program if substance use disorder is identified.

  • Complete community service or other court-mandated activities.


Following these recommendations is crucial. It shows your commitment to change and can positively impact your legal outcome.


Remember, these services are not just about fulfilling requirements. They are about helping you build a healthier lifestyle and avoid future problems.
